First Look with The Post’s Toluse Olorunnipa, George F. Will and Jennifer Rubin
On Washington Post Live’s “First Look,” associate editor Jonathan Capehart speaks with The Post’s Toluse Olorunnipa, George F. Will and Jennifer Rubin about the death of Tyre Nichols and President Biden’s meeting with leaders of the Congressional Black Caucus.
Conversation recorded on Friday, Feb. 3, 2023.
